ISO 11118:1999

Gas cylinders -- Non-refillable metallic gas cylinders -- Specification and test methods


This International Standard specifies minimum requirements for the material, design, construction and workmanship, manufacturing processes and tests at manufacture of non-refillable metallic gas cylinders of welded, brazed or seamless construction for compressed, liquefied and dissolved gases exposed to extreme worldwide ambient temperatures.

This International Standard is applicable to cylinders where:

  • the maximum permissible operating pressure does not exceed 250 bar (i.e. pms ≤ 250 bar);
  • the product of the maximum permissible operating pressure and the water capacity does not exceed 1000 bar.litres (i.e.pms · V ≤ 1000 bar.l);
  • where the maximum permissible operating pressure exceeds 35 bar, the water capacity does not exceed 5 l (i.e. for pms> 35 bar, then V ≤ 5 l).

This International Standard is not applicable to cylinders exceeding these pressure and volume limits, for which reference may be made to refillable cylinder standards.

This International Standard is also not applicable to cartridges/aerosol dispensers1) and spherical containers.

1) Cartridges are non-refillable containers which do not contain an integral dispensing device, have a maximum water capacity of 1 l and have a limited maximum permissible operating pressure (as defined by the country of use). Aerosol dispensers are non-refillable thin-walled containers which do contain an integral dispensing device, have a maximum water capacity of 1 l and have a limited maximum permissible operating pressure (as defined by the country of use).
